Abstract
A charging control system that controls charging of an automobile that uses electric power as motive power include a receiving unit that receives electric power demands from an electric power supplier side; and a control unit that controls charging on and off of the automobile. The control unit changes a ratio of a charging-on duration and a charging-off duration in each duration in allowable charging durations for the automobile according to changes of the electric power demands over time.

1. A charging control system that controls charging of an automobile that uses electric power as motive power, comprising:
-
a receiving unit that receives electric power demands from an electric power supplier side; and a control unit that controls charging on and off of said automobile, wherein said control unit changes a ratio of a charging-on duration and a charging-off duration in each duration in allowable charging durations for said automobile according to changes of said electric power demands over time, wherein said control unit includes; a first calculation unit that causes a required charging duration at which said automobile is charged in a predetermined charged state at a specific charging speed of said automobile to be divided by each of said allowable charging durations so as to calculate a reference value of the ratio of said charging-on duration and each of said allowable charging durations; a second calculation unit that causes a demand ratio function based on time changes of said electric power demands to be multiplied by said reference value so as to calculate a setting value of the ratio of said charging-on duration and each of said allowable charging durations; and a charging control unit that controls charging on and off based on said setting value. - View Dependent Claims (2, 3)
